Runbook note: the Tillgate payments integration tests flake under parallel runs. Retry once serially before blocking the release. If ledger-reconciliation tests still fail, hold the deploy and page the payments rotation. Once green, tag the build and sign the release artifact with the key below:

rollout seal: bky4_x7Gc

### Key Ceremony Checklist — Item 7: PickFlow Optimizer Signing Key

Before sealing the envelope, confirm that both witnesses from the Larkmoor plugin council have initialed the ledger and that the PickFlow signing key was generated on the air-gapped workstation, never on a networked machine. Verify the checksum read-back matches the printed record exactly. Once both verifications are complete, record in the ledger the recovery passphrase that was generated, shown here for transcription:

strongbox words: zordor-quenax

Ticket: Canary gate vault locked

Canary deploys on Skylark are blocked. The vault storing gating rules locked itself after three bad unlock attempts last night. Don't touch the gating config by hand. From the deploy bastion, run the vault recovery prompt, confirm the environment is staging-east, and proceed. Enter the recovery passphrase on the line below exactly as shown.

vault phrase of hawif-bahof = novvan-belius-istael-fenvan-holdor-druox-eliath

Action item: The Relayn deploy-status bot silently dropped updates when the pipeline API paginated results, so responders believed a rollback had completed when it had not. We will add pagination handling, a staleness banner, and an integration test. Until merged, verify deploy state directly in the pipeline console, documented at the page below.

runbook for kahop-kajop: https://rundeck.ordinio.test/display/secrets/pipeline/issue/pages/repo/browse/e5732776e07d1285107e5aeb

Launch plan for Orvane, our scheduling platform, is locked for the Halveth market. Beta closed with 340 accounts; churn under 3%. Pricing tiers approved by the commercial committee last week. Marketing spend front-loaded: 60% in the first eight weeks, anchored on trade events in Dunmere. Supply and support staffing confirmed; no open risks rated above medium. Launch date holds unless regulatory review in Halveth slips. Decision needed today on the enterprise tier discount. The confidential strategic note is appended below.

internal memo for yahaf-hawif: The finance team signed off on a budget of $59.9 million for Project Rusax.